PSR-E303/YPT-300 Owner’s Manual 27
Quick Guide
Turn ACMP (auto accompaniment) on or off,
depending on what you want to record.
If you want to record Style playback, turn ACMP on. If you
want to record only your own keyboard performance, turn
ACMP off.
Specify the track you want to record.
Specify the track 2 when you want to record the Style.
When you want to record your own keyboard performance, you
can specify either track.
Recording to Track 1
Press the [REC] button and [REC TRACK 1] button
simultaneously.
Recording to Track 2
Press the [REC] button and [REC TRACK 2] button
simultaneously.
Press the [+], [-] buttons to select the User Song you want to record.
If you want to record Style playback to Track 2, press the
[STYLE] button and select the desired Style.
Start recording
Perform steps 2 and 3 on pages 25-26.
By playing keys to the left of the Split Point when the Auto
Accompaniment is set to on, the Style starts sounding and is
recorded. Only your performance is recorded by playing the
keyboard (any key is OK) when the Auto Accompaniment is set
to off.

•Keep in mind that both Tracks
1 and 2 will be overwritten
with new data if you record
without specifying the tracks.
The both “L” and “R” flashes,
this indicates that you have
specified Track 1 when the
Auto Accompaniment is on. If
you want to record your own
performance, press the
[TRACK 2] button to stop the
“L” flashing. If you want to
record a Style, press the
[REC] button to cancel the
recording, and repeat the pro-
cedure from the beginning.
